Sandy Muirhead

Partner and co-founder, Phoenix Equity Partners

Sandy Muirhead is a co-founder and former managing partner of Phoenix Equity Partners, a UK-based mid-market private equity firm.15 He co-founded the firm in 2001 along with Hugh Lenon and James Thomas.1 Although he stepped down from his role as managing partner in 20145, Muirhead continues to be involved with Phoenix Equity Partners as a senior adviser, focusing on financial services sector investment activity.7

Throughout his career at Phoenix, Muirhead has been involved in several significant investments and transactions. He played a key role in the sale of Key Retirement Group (KRG) to Partners Group for £208 million, which delivered a return of approximately 4.5 times Phoenix's investment cost.2 He was also involved in Phoenix's investment in Redington, an independent institutional investment consultant.3

Currently, Muirhead serves as a Non-Executive Director at Mobius Life Limited.4 He is also a trustee of the Royal Horticultural Society.6 Muirhead's educational background includes studying at the University of Oxford.4
